Job Description

Administrator, Educational Affiliations Job Summary :
The Administrator of Educational Affiliations will be responsible for management of educational affiliation agreements and program letters of agreement for 50+ GME programs, 200 annual GME in-rotations, and physician assistant in-rotations to ensure congruence between ACGME reporting, residency management system (New Innovations) tracking, and GME cost reports. The Administrator will be responsible for partnering with the DIO to ensure current and accurate agreements and will prepare dashboards and instutional-level reports. This role involves working closely with GME program-level administrators and communicating with collaborating instutions and programs.
Responsibilities:
Manages all aspects of affiliation agreement preparation and tracking for the GME Office. Ensures compliance of agreements with ACGME and related requirements. Ensures and tracks congruence between ACGME reporting and residency management system utilization, and assists in addressing compliance in GME cost reports. Engages with program leadership and outside stakeholders. Prepares dashboards and institional reports related to educational affiliations and rotations. Partners with the GME Onboarding Administrator to confirm and track applicable professional liability coverage and adherence to required onboarding components. Undertakes special projects and assignments as directed.
Qualifications/Requirements:
Experience:
2 years of experience in program administration in a health professions training clinical settings, public health, health regulatory, or health services setting or related organization/program, required. Experience in agreement management preferred. Graduate Medical Education experience, preferred
Education:
Bachelor's degree required Licenses /
Certifications:
TAGME certification, preferred
